Identify the Type of Damage

Begin by inspecting your roof to see what kind of damage you’re dealing with. Check for missing shingles, leaks, or cracks around vents and chimneys. Some problems might look small, but can lead to bigger issues if ignored.

Knowing whether the damage is caused by wear, weather, or structural issues helps you take the right steps. A careful inspection also helps you explain the problem better when you seek help.

Remember, understanding your roof’s condition is the first step to restoring its strength and protection.

Prioritize Safety First

Before doing anything, make sure safety comes first. Avoid climbing on the roof during storms or when it’s slippery. Use sturdy ladders and protective gear if you must take a closer look.

Keep others, especially kids and pets, away from the area until you know it’s safe. Sometimes, it’s best to wait for professionals instead of risking injury.

Roof repairs can be tricky, and your well-being matters more than a quick fix. Taking safety precautions ensures a smooth, accident-free repair process every time.

Temporary Fixes

If you can’t get immediate help, try simple temporary fixes to control the damage. Use waterproof tarps or roof sealants to stop leaks from spreading.

A quick patch-up can protect your home’s interior from water damage until experts arrive. Be sure to check your attic for any moisture buildup, too. Temporary solutions aren’t permanent, but they buy you time to plan proper repairs.

Acting fast can save you from costly damages and unnecessary stress later on. It’s all about quick thinking and smart prevention.
